Output 3eda847579dbe5d5921d114b85db1dab53a8e6c5d76c127a1cd705cb2efff57d:66

value
35602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a95e07535937ed9035571baf1082292d5f78782e OP_EQUAL
address
3H8YmBjQtaiEyFDvtqMxLrkhuBmJ6ViFB3
transaction
3eda847579dbe5d5921d114b85db1dab53a8e6c5d76c127a1cd705cb2efff57d
spent
true